☐ Step 7 — Verify pagination contract before sealing. Confirm the public Lanternwick REST API returns cursor-based pagination on every list endpoint, that `next_cursor` is opaque and stable across replicas, and that page sizes are capped at 100 with a documented default of 25. Reviewer must diff the OpenAPI spec against the deployed gateway and initial both copies. Once the pagination check passes, the ceremony officer unseals the escrow envelope and reads out the recovery passphrase aloud for transcription below.

recovery phrase for bawep-kawef: oliath-casdor

- [ ] Verify role-based access on Brackenhall wiki post-deploy. Confirm: Viewer role cannot edit or see draft pages; Editor role cannot change space permissions; Admin changes are logged to the audit stream. Run the smoke script in `ops/rbac-check` against all three seeded accounts. If any check fails, roll back the permissions migration before anything else — do not hotfix in place. Page the access-control owner if rollback doesn't clear it. Record results in the deploy log, referencing the build token below.

pipeline stamp: htk31_f769b577b3028a4e9958e5bb8d1259a

// Client setup for the Splitgrove assignment service.
// Plugin authors: assignments are resolved server-side; do not cache
// variant results locally for longer than the session. The client
// retries twice on timeout, then falls back to the control arm.
// Initialize against the sandbox endpoint first and verify your
// experiment slug resolves. Authenticate the client with the key below.

service key, hawif-kadup: vxb7-VMYtoba

Off-site run checklist — item 7: Leased laptop returns (Quillbrook lease, batch two). Verify all nineteen machines are present against the return manifest, each wiped per the Astervale decommissioning procedure and labelled with its asset tag on the lid. Pack in the supplied anti-static sleeves, maximum five per crate, chargers and docks in the separate accessories box. Crates must be strapped and seal numbers recorded before the Dornick Logistics van departs. At the receiving site, release the crates only after the courier recites this phrase:

courier memo of yawep-yafog: the pramir ulaix courier leaves the ulavan aldix frair zorok oliiel joreth rusdor fenvan ledger at gate 1305 under passcode 514738